在互联网时代,网站已经成为企业、组织和个人展示自我和提供服务的重要平台。当用户发现无法访问一个网站时,这不仅会影响用户体验,还可能导致业务中断。以下是造成网站服务器无法访问的十大常见原因及其相应的解决方案。
1. DNS解析问题
DNS(域名系统)是将人类可读的域名转换为计算机能够理解的IP地址的过程。如果DNS配置错误或服务器出现问题,可能会导致域名无法正确解析到对应的IP地址,从而影响网站访问。解决办法包括检查DNS设置是否正确、更新DNS记录或更换DNS服务商。
2. 网络连接不稳定
无论是本地网络还是服务器所在的数据中心网络出现故障,都可能使用户无法正常连接到服务器。确保网络环境稳定可靠非常重要。建议定期测试网络性能,并与网络供应商保持良好沟通,以便及时处理突发情况。
3. 服务器硬件故障
服务器本身的硬件组件如硬盘、内存等发生故障也会导致无法访问。对于这种情况,需要联系托管服务提供商进行硬件维护或者考虑迁移至更稳定的服务器环境。
4. 软件冲突或漏洞
操作系统、应用程序之间存在兼容性问题,或是某些软件存在安全漏洞未被修复,也可能引发网站无法访问的问题。定期更新所有相关软件版本并打上最新的安全补丁可以有效预防此类事件的发生。
5. 流量过载
当大量请求短时间内涌向服务器时,超出了其处理能力,则会造成响应缓慢甚至完全瘫痪。为应对这种状况,可以通过优化代码提高效率、增加带宽资源以及采用负载均衡技术来分散流量压力。
6. DoS/DDoS攻击
恶意攻击者通过发送大量无效请求给目标服务器,使其无法正常服务于合法用户的请求。部署专业的防护措施如防火墙、入侵检测系统等可以帮助抵御这些攻击。
7. 数据库连接失败
很多动态网页都需要依赖数据库存储数据信息,一旦数据库连接失败就会导致页面加载不完整或根本无法显示。确保数据库服务正常运行,同时合理规划数据库架构以提高容错性和扩展性。
8. SSL证书失效
HTTPS协议下使用的SSL/TLS证书到期后若没有及时更新,浏览器会提示警告阻止用户继续浏览。因此要密切关注证书的有效期,在它即将过期前做好续费工作。
9. 文件权限设置不当
Web服务器上的文件夹和文件应当拥有正确的读写权限,否则即使服务器本身运作良好也无法正确展示内容。根据实际需求调整好各个目录下的权限分配,保证既不影响安全性又能满足日常操作要求。
10. 缺乏有效的监控机制
缺乏对服务器状态的实时监测很容易错过一些潜在的问题。建立一套完善的监控体系,包括但不限于CPU使用率、内存占用情况、磁盘空间剩余量等方面,可以提前预警并快速定位问题根源。
为了确保网站服务器始终保持最佳状态,我们需要从多个角度出发进行全面管理和维护。希望以上提到的原因及对策能够帮助大家更好地理解和解决遇到的相关难题。
文章推荐更多>
- 1夸克怎么搜电影资源 电影资源搜索指南
- 2oracle数据库delete删除的数据怎么恢复
- 3oracle数据库怎么删除注册表
- 4wordpress怎么上传外观主题
- 5redis数据库双写一致问题怎么写
- 6phpmyadmin怎么删除一行
- 7oracle数据库密码怎么修改
- 8uc浏览器可以解压7z吗 uc支持7z格式解压操作教程
- 9手机UC视频转存到U盘
- 10怎么备份oracle数据库表
- 11wordpress怎么打开很慢
- 12UC缓存视频导出到电脑步骤
- 13 个人摄影网站制作流程,摄影爱好者都去什么网站?
- 14wordpress的插件怎么安装
- 15oracle数据库怎么查询几个结构相同的表
- 16Metasploit模块开发:自定义漏洞利用脚本
- 17 公司网站制作需要多少钱,找人做公司网站需要多少钱?
- 18如何打开谷歌浏览器 浏览器快捷启动方式汇总
- 19wordpress的自动翻译插件怎么使用
- 20电脑怎么截屏ctrl加什么 截屏组合键使用技巧
- 21夸克浏览器怎么找资源的步骤 夸克浏览器资源搜索技巧分享
- 22redis缓存一般存些什么数据
- 23量子加密:QKD密钥分发与抗量子算法
- 24wordpress如何设置定时发布文章
- 25oracle数据库备份方法主要有哪几种
- 26wordpress网站如何设置伪静态
- 27怎么上传wordpress到虚拟主机
- 28电脑黑屏只有鼠标 黑屏鼠标指针问题修复
- 29电脑拼音打字怎么切换 输入法切换技巧分享
- 30oracle数据库怎么查询哪些是新加的表
